Practicum in Special Education and Pupil Services

This course involves field-based projects addressing each of the state administrator standards and guidelines for a director of special education and pupil services. The activities will be determined by the student and assigned local mentor with input from the university practicum advisor. Evidence will be provided in the student portfolio, along with their reflections. To start the course the student will provide a prospectus (plan) of the kinds of activities and the approximate number of hours spent on each activity, aligned to the standards. Prerequisite: admission to the Director of Special Education and Pupil Services licensure program. Restricted to students in the Director of Special Education and Pupil Services licensure programs.
